Set Up the Captions and Fillout Integration

Use various Latenode nodes to transform data and enhance your integration:

  • Branching: Create multiple branches within the scenario to handle complex logic.
  • Merging: Combine different node branches into one, passing data through it.
  • Plug n Play Nodes: Use nodes that don’t require account credentials.
  • Ask AI: Use the GPT-powered option to add AI capabilities to any node.
  • Wait: Set waiting times, either for intervals or until specific dates.
  • Sub-scenarios (Nodules): Create sub-scenarios that are encapsulated in a single node.
  • Iteration: Process arrays of data when needed.
  • Code: Write custom code or ask our AI assistant to do it for you.

Save and Activate the Scenario

After configuring Captions, Fillout, and any additional nodes, don’t forget to save the scenario and click "Deploy." Activating the scenario ensures it will run automatically whenever the trigger node receives input or a condition is met. By default, all newly created scenarios are deactivated.

Test the Scenario

Run the scenario by clicking “Run once” and triggering an event to check if the Captions and Fillout integration works as expected. Depending on your setup, data should flow between Captions and Fillout (or vice versa). Easily troubleshoot the scenario by reviewing the execution history to identify and fix any issues.

Most powerful ways to connect Captions and Fillout

Fillout + Captions + Google Sheets: When a new submission is received in Fillout, it triggers a video generation request in Captions. The details of the request and the generated video are then added to a Google Sheet for tracking progress.

Fillout + Captions + Slack: When a new video request form is submitted via Fillout, a video generation request is created in Captions. Slack then sends a message to a specified channel notifying the video editors that a new caption request is ready to be created.

Are there any limitations to the Captions and Fillout integration on Latenode?

While the integration is powerful, there are certain limitations to be aware of:

  • Complex data transformations might require advanced JavaScript knowledge.
  • Large volumes of transcript data may impact workflow execution time.
  • Real-time updates depend on the API availability of both Captions and Fillout.
